Gibson Sheat Partner appointed as IRB Judicial Officer

Peter Hobbs, one of the partners here at Gibson Sheat, recently returned from two weeks in South Africa.  Peter was appointed by the IRB to act as a Judicial Officer for the first five games of the British and Irish Lions Tour of South Africa.

A Judicial Officer's role is to conduct a hearing if a player is cited by the Citing Commissioner for an act of illegal or foul play during a match or having received a red card by the referee.  The hearing determines whether or not any allegation of illegal foul play has been established and what, if any, penalty should be handed down to the player in question.  Somewhat unexpectedly there were no citings or red cards in any of the matches Peter was responsible for.  "A Lions Tour of South Africa is a highly anticipated event that only comes around once every 12 years.  It creates a great deal of interest and passion.  The games I was involved with were, however, all played in a very good spirit, with no illegal or foul play needing my attention.

With no hearings to consider, Peter was left to experience and enjoy much of what South Africa has to offer.  "South Africa is a fascinating place and a land of great contrast.  It was a great privilege to be part of such a unique and exciting Rugby Tour, albeit in a very minor way.

Peter has two further international assignments this year;  one in Samoa and a second in Perth for a Tri Nations Test between South Africa and Australia.
